The increased maintenance requirement for work permits is now in force
As of today, 1 November, work permit applicants are now subject to the increased maintenance requirement. The new requirement, which was decided by the Government, means that you must have a salary that corresponds to at least 80 per cent of the median salary in Sweden.

How the increased maintenance requirement affects work permit applicants
The Government has decided to raise the maintenance requirement for applicants for a work permit in Sweden. The new requirement comes into force on 1 November and means that you must earn a monthly salary of at least SEK 27,360.
